The First Nowell , Ancient Song, from Heart Songs-1909

     "The first Nowell the angels did say,  was to certain poor shepherds in fields where they lay--

       In fields where they lay keeping their sheep,  On a cold winter's night, that was so deep.

       Chorus

        Nowell,  Nowell, Nowell, Nowell, Born is the King of Israel.


        They looked above and saw a star,  As it shown in the east but beyond them far;

         And to the earth it gave great light,  And continued so both day and night.

         Chorus

         And by the light of that same bright star

         There  were three wise men came from the east county far;

         To seek the King it was their intent,

         And to follow the star wherever it went.

         Chorus

          The star drew nigh unto the north-west;

           Over Bethlehem - paused, and there it did rest

          And there did stay  over where the young Child and His mother lay.

          Chorus

          Then entered in those wise men all three

           Very reverently upon bended knee

            ANd offered there in his presence

            Gifts of gold and of myrrh and of frankincense.

              Chorus

              Then let us all with one accord

              Sing praises praises unto our heavenly  Lord,

              That made the heavens and earth of naught,

               And with His blood man-kind hath bought.

                Chorus "
